What exactly is a Die-Solid Heating Aspect?

A Die-Forged Heating Ingredient is a robust element designed working with die-casting technology, exactly where molten steel—generally aluminum—is injected into a mildew all around a heating coil. This production course of action makes a compact and really strong structure with uniform warmth distribution.

Vital benefits include:

Higher thermal conductivity

Superb mechanical strength

Efficient warmth transfer

Resistance to corrosion and have on

Extensive lifespan even underneath ongoing significant-temperature operation

These qualities make die-cast heating elements perfect for industries for example house appliances, industrial machinery, HVAC systems, and h2o heating products.

Die-Cast Aluminum Heating Tube: Light-weight and Productive

A specialized method of die-Solid heating component will be the Die-Forged Aluminum Heating Tube, recognized for its extraordinary mix of energy and lightweight development. Aluminum’s organic thermal properties help more rapidly heating and far better energy effectiveness.

Advantages of Die-Solid Aluminum Heating Tubes:

Fast and uniform warmth distribution

Lightweight nevertheless tough framework

Price-helpful creation

Superior corrosion resistance in comparison to regular metal tubes

Suited to purposes requiring swift heat-up cycles

These tubes are commonly Utilized in electric powered water heaters, industrial boilers, property appliances, and automotive heating systems.

Stainless-steel Heating Ingredient: Durability and Corrosion Resistance

In programs wherever Intense sturdiness and corrosion resistance are expected, a Chrome Die-Cast Heating Element steel Heating Component is usually the preferred alternative. Made from top quality-grade chrome steel, these features are developed to withstand harsh environments, substantial humidity, and corrosive ailments.

Why Choose Stainless Steel Heating Components?

Excellent corrosion resistance

Significant-temperature resilience

Very long operational life

Perfect for h2o heating, chemical methods, and food-processing equipment

Ideal for sanitary environments as a result of hygienic Homes

These heating aspects are commonly found in industrial heaters, water immersion heaters, HVAC systems, and professional cooking machines.
